At its core, the Uniop ETOP12-0052 features a 12-inch color touchscreen display with enhanced resolution, delivering crisp visualization of process data and control parameters. Its input/output capacity supports multiple communication protocols, including Modbus, CANbus, and Ethernet, enabling flexible integration with various PLCs and automation systems. The device supports up to 32 digital and analog inputs and outputs, facilitating comprehensive process control and monitoring. This high level of I/O capacity ensures that the ETOP12-0052 can handle intricate automation tasks without compromising responsiveness or accuracy.
Durability is a hallmark of the ETOP12-0052. Built to withstand harsh industrial conditions, it boasts an IP65-rated front panel, protecting it against dust and water ingress. Its robust casing and shock-resistant design ensure reliable operation even under vibration or temperature fluctuations common in power plants and petrochemical facilities. The unit operates efficiently within a temperature range from -10°C to 60°C, making it suitable for both indoor and moderately harsh outdoor environments.
